<r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Hacker News: maowtm</title><link>https://news.ycombinator.com/user?id=maowtm</link><description>Hacker News RSS</description><docs>https://hnrss.org/</docs><generator>hnrss v2.1.1</generator><lastBuildDate>Mon, 06 Apr 2026 06:19:32 +0000</lastBuildDate><atom:link href="https://hnrss.org/user?id=maowtm" rel="self" type="application/rss+xml"></atom:link><item><title><![CDATA[New comment by maowtm in "Transition to using 16 KB page sizes for Android apps and games"]]></title><description><![CDATA[
<p>Transistors aren't free (as in power consumptions, thermal etc), and wasting them on implementing 1 byte granularity TLBs would probably be a hard sell, even if assuming everything can indeed be done in parallel.</p>
]]></description><pubDate>Wed, 16 Jul 2025 00:37:04 +0000</pubDate><link>https://news.ycombinator.com/item?id=44577473</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=44577473</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=44577473</guid></item><item><title><![CDATA[New comment by maowtm in "Show HN: I compressed 10k PDFs into a 1.4GB video for LLM memory"]]></title><description><![CDATA[
<p>what</p>
]]></description><pubDate>Sun, 08 Jun 2025 19:21:53 +0000</pubDate><link>https://news.ycombinator.com/item?id=44218987</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=44218987</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=44218987</guid></item><item><title><![CDATA[New comment by maowtm in "Using the Linux kernel to help me crack an executable quickly"]]></title><description><![CDATA[
<p>Thanks a lot :)</p>
]]></description><pubDate>Mon, 21 Apr 2025 16:22:29 +0000</pubDate><link>https://news.ycombinator.com/item?id=43753694</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=43753694</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=43753694</guid></item><item><title><![CDATA[New comment by maowtm in "Using the Linux kernel to help me crack an executable quickly"]]></title><description><![CDATA[
<p>An article which I have been ~procrastinating~ working on over the past few months and finally finished!<p>It is quite long, but I've been told it's an interesting read for some audiences.  Let me know what you think :)</p>
]]></description><pubDate>Mon, 21 Apr 2025 02:39:19 +0000</pubDate><link>https://news.ycombinator.com/item?id=43748087</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=43748087</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=43748087</guid></item><item><title><![CDATA[Using the Linux kernel to help me crack an executable quickly]]></title><description><![CDATA[
<p>Article URL: <a href="https://blog.maowtm.org/linux-ick/en.html">https://blog.maowtm.org/linux-ick/en.html</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=43748086">https://news.ycombinator.com/item?id=43748086</a></p>
<p>Points: 30</p>
<p># Comments: 4</p>
]]></description><pubDate>Mon, 21 Apr 2025 02:39:19 +0000</pubDate><link>https://blog.maowtm.org/linux-ick/en.html</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=43748086</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=43748086</guid></item><item><title><![CDATA[New comment by maowtm in "Updates to H-1B"]]></title><description><![CDATA[
<p>Not the UK at least, as someone who has done a completely in-country switch from student to skilled worker. In fact you are not allowed to leave the country when your application is in progress (leaving would cancel it).</p>
]]></description><pubDate>Wed, 25 Dec 2024 02:59:14 +0000</pubDate><link>https://news.ycombinator.com/item?id=42506541</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=42506541</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=42506541</guid></item><item><title><![CDATA[NPM Install Everything, and the Complete and Utter Chaos That Follows]]></title><description><![CDATA[
<p>Article URL: <a href="https://boehs.org/node/npm-everything">https://boehs.org/node/npm-everything</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=39717150">https://news.ycombinator.com/item?id=39717150</a></p>
<p>Points: 54</p>
<p># Comments: 17</p>
]]></description><pubDate>Fri, 15 Mar 2024 15:53:39 +0000</pubDate><link>https://boehs.org/node/npm-everything</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=39717150</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=39717150</guid></item><item><title><![CDATA[New comment by maowtm in "Next.js 14"]]></title><description><![CDATA[
<p>> Didn't realize I needed to put this together for you,</p>
]]></description><pubDate>Fri, 03 Nov 2023 11:00:26 +0000</pubDate><link>https://news.ycombinator.com/item?id=38126907</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=38126907</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=38126907</guid></item><item><title><![CDATA[New comment by maowtm in "Find a good available .com domain"]]></title><description><![CDATA[
<p>You can also do that with certificate transparency logs though.</p>
]]></description><pubDate>Fri, 10 Jun 2022 12:03:05 +0000</pubDate><link>https://news.ycombinator.com/item?id=31692846</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=31692846</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=31692846</guid></item><item><title><![CDATA[How Certificate Transparency Works]]></title><description><![CDATA[
<p>Article URL: <a href="https://blog.maowtm.org/ct/en.html">https://blog.maowtm.org/ct/en.html</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=23814292">https://news.ycombinator.com/item?id=23814292</a></p>
<p>Points: 1</p>
<p># Comments: 0</p>
]]></description><pubDate>Sun, 12 Jul 2020 20:01:35 +0000</pubDate><link>https://blog.maowtm.org/ct/en.html</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=23814292</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=23814292</guid></item><item><title><![CDATA[New comment by maowtm in "When in doubt: hang up, look up, and call back"]]></title><description><![CDATA[
<p>But how...<p>Isn't bank cards designed to be non-cloneable (with crypto chips)?</p>
]]></description><pubDate>Fri, 01 May 2020 14:04:18 +0000</pubDate><link>https://news.ycombinator.com/item?id=23042070</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=23042070</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=23042070</guid></item><item><title><![CDATA[New comment by maowtm in "TLS Performance: Rustls versus OpenSSL"]]></title><description><![CDATA[
<p>Rust works pretty well with C, and you could use cbindgen[0] to generate c headers for rust functions marked as extern and it would work when linked together. <i>However</i>, rustls doesn't seems to be providing any such function. Most of its API is rust-based, using stuff that isn't directly available in C (Option, Vec, etc.). So you would have to write at least some rust code that calls the library, and have your C code calls the rust code that you write.<p>On the flip side, calling C code in rust is pretty easy - you have the entire libc available, and rust-bindgen[1] generate bindings for you, which in my experience works very well. So, you may also consider writing your program in rust… If that's possible.<p><pre><code>  [0]: https://github.com/eqrion/cbindgen
  [1]: https://github.com/rust-lang/rust-bindgen</code></pre></p>
]]></description><pubDate>Fri, 05 Jul 2019 07:52:54 +0000</pubDate><link>https://news.ycombinator.com/item?id=20360655</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=20360655</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=20360655</guid></item><item><title><![CDATA[Show HN: JavaScript Moving and Zooming Handler]]></title><description><![CDATA[
<p>Article URL: <a href="https://github.com/micromaomao/transformationstage">https://github.com/micromaomao/transformationstage</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=19471318">https://news.ycombinator.com/item?id=19471318</a></p>
<p>Points: 1</p>
<p># Comments: 0</p>
]]></description><pubDate>Sat, 23 Mar 2019 17:19:12 +0000</pubDate><link>https://github.com/micromaomao/transformationstage</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=19471318</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=19471318</guid></item><item><title><![CDATA[Show HN: Ts-player: Flexible terminal recorder]]></title><description><![CDATA[
<p>Article URL: <a href="https://github.com/micromaomao/ts-player">https://github.com/micromaomao/ts-player</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=19105772">https://news.ycombinator.com/item?id=19105772</a></p>
<p>Points: 4</p>
<p># Comments: 0</p>
]]></description><pubDate>Thu, 07 Feb 2019 15:33:19 +0000</pubDate><link>https://github.com/micromaomao/ts-player</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=19105772</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=19105772</guid></item><item><title><![CDATA[New comment by maowtm in "Physics puzzles"]]></title><description><![CDATA[
<p>THANK YOU!!!</p>
]]></description><pubDate>Fri, 04 Jan 2019 13:24:47 +0000</pubDate><link>https://news.ycombinator.com/item?id=18823792</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=18823792</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=18823792</guid></item><item><title><![CDATA[New comment by maowtm in "Show HN: Countdownto.xyz – Make a minimalist countdown to any event"]]></title><description><![CDATA[
<p>Useful tool, liked.</p>
]]></description><pubDate>Sun, 21 Oct 2018 11:17:21 +0000</pubDate><link>https://news.ycombinator.com/item?id=18267530</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=18267530</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=18267530</guid></item><item><title><![CDATA[New comment by maowtm in "Show HN: A tool to generate pseudorandom, deterministic passwords"]]></title><description><![CDATA[
<p>I have personally been using an earlier version of this tool (also written by me) myself for a long time… Then I decided to rewrite it in Golang and improve things, so this came out. Looking for suggestions and reviews…</p>
]]></description><pubDate>Sun, 21 Oct 2018 10:49:11 +0000</pubDate><link>https://news.ycombinator.com/item?id=18267458</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=18267458</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=18267458</guid></item><item><title><![CDATA[Show HN: A tool to generate pseudorandom, deterministic passwords]]></title><description><![CDATA[
<p>Article URL: <a href="https://github.com/micromaomao/go-ecbpass">https://github.com/micromaomao/go-ecbpass</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=18267457">https://news.ycombinator.com/item?id=18267457</a></p>
<p>Points: 5</p>
<p># Comments: 2</p>
]]></description><pubDate>Sun, 21 Oct 2018 10:49:00 +0000</pubDate><link>https://github.com/micromaomao/go-ecbpass</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=18267457</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=18267457</guid></item><item><title><![CDATA[“Remote Arbitrary Code Execution” Through JavaScript]]></title><description><![CDATA[
<p>Article URL: <a href="https://bugzilla.mozilla.org/show_bug.cgi?id=1487081">https://bugzilla.mozilla.org/show_bug.cgi?id=1487081</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=18032710">https://news.ycombinator.com/item?id=18032710</a></p>
<p>Points: 1</p>
<p># Comments: 0</p>
]]></description><pubDate>Thu, 20 Sep 2018 14:35:24 +0000</pubDate><link>https://bugzilla.mozilla.org/show_bug.cgi?id=1487081</link><dc:creator>maowtm</dc:creator><comments>https://news.ycombinator.com/item?id=18032710</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=18032710</guid></item></channel></rss>